DEFECT #1 - STEERING:COLUMN


Posted on: 2009-09-15
Description
Daimler trucks is recalling certain model year 2010 thomas built school buses and freightliner business class m2 medium duty trucks and freightliner custom chassis s2 vehicles manufactured between april 21 and july 2, 2009, equipped with trw igen 3 intermediate steering columns.  The weld around the steering shaft tube that secures the spline tube to the intermediate tube may be mislocated (i.e., not fully over the seam created when the tubes are pressed together.)

Consequence
Mislocated welds may result in torsional and axial strength falling below acceptable levels.  This condition could result in separation of the steering column, loss of steering control and a vehicle crash without warning.

Corrective Action
Daimler trucks will notify owners and the vehicles will be repaired free of charge.  The safety recall began on november 6, 2009.  Owners may contact daimler trucks toll-free at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#2 - EXTERIOR LIGHTING:BRAKE LIGHTS:SWITCH


Posted on: 2010-04-30
Description
Dtna is recalling certain model year 2005 through 2011 freightliner business class c2, fccc b2 chassis, s2 chassis, and mc chassis manufactured beginning january 19, 2005 through april 16, 2010.  The stop lamps may be intermittent during light brake applications.

Consequence
The stop lamps may not properly indicate that the service brakes are applied which may lead to a crash without warning.

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ners and repairs will be performed by dtna dealerships free of charge.  The safety recall began on may 27, 2011.  Owners may contact dtna at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#4 - 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ING


Posted on: 2010-10-12
Description
Daimler trucks is recalling certain model year 2007 through 2010 freightliner business class m2, custom chassis mt45, s2 chassis, and stering acterra vehicles manufactured from october 5, 2006, through may 24, 2010, equipped with epa 2007 mbe 900 detroit diesel engines.  Engine software may not react properly to certain aftermarket treatment device fault codes.  The software may unnecessarily shutdown a vehicle or may fail to shutdown a vehicle with an aftermarket device over-temp fault.

Consequence
Unexpected shutdown of a vehicle may increase the risk of a crash.  Overheating of the aftertreatment device without engine shutdown may result in a fire.

Corrective Action
Daimler trucks will notify owners and repairs will be performed by detroit diesel free of charge.  The safety recall began on december 30, 2010.  Owners may contact daimler trucks at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#5 - STEERING:COLUMN


Posted on: 2010-07-13
Description
Daimler trucks (dtna) is recalling certain model year 2009 and 2010 freightliner business class m2, sterling acterra, a-line, and l-line heavy trucks manufactured from september 8, 2008 through april 20, 2009 equipped with trw igen3 intermediate steering columns.  The weld around the igen3 steering shaft tube that secures the spline tube to the intermediate tube may be mislocated (i.e., not fully over the seam created when the tubes are pressed together.)

Consequence
Mislocated welds may result in torsional and axial strength falling below acceptable levels.  This condition could result in separation of the steering column, loss of steering control and a vehicle crash without warning.

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ners and the buses will be repaired free of charge.  The safety recall began on december 23, 2010.  Owners may contact dtna at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#6 - SEAT BELTS:FRONT:ANCHORAGE


Posted on: 2011-01-12
Description
Daimler trucks is recalling certain model year 2010 freightliner business class m2 vehicles manufactured from august 25, 2009, through september 3, 2009.  These vehicles were built with out of specification inboard seat belt anchor plates that are not as robust as intended.

Consequence
In the event of an a crash, the seat belt anchorage may not continue to hold in place the seat belt apparatus, increasing the risk of the belt not restraining the seat occupant as intended, and increasing the risk of injury to the occupant.

Corrective Action
Daimler trucks will repair the vehicles and replace the existing seat belt anchor as necessary free of charge.  The safety recall is expected to begin on or before march 11, 2011.  Owners may contact daimler trucks at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#7 - EQUIPMENT


Posted on: 2012-08-16
Description
Daimler trucks north america (dtna) is recalling certain model year 2009-2012 freightliner, sterling, and western star vehicles manufactured from july 7, 2008, through december 15, 2011, and equipped with perpendicular air tank mounting brackets.  The air tank mounting brackets may develop cracks which can lead to the air tank brackets separating from the frame rail.  The air tanks may also separate from the vehicle.  

Consequence
Air tanks that become separated from a moving vehicle may create a road debris hazard, increasing the risk of a crash.  

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ners, and dealers will replace the air mounting brackets, free of charge.  The recall began on december 24, 2012.  Owners may contact daimler trucks north america toll free at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#8 - 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E:DIESEL


Posted on: 2012-02-28
Description
Daimler trucks (dtna) is recalling certain model year 2006-2013 freightliner, sterling, and western star vehicles, equipped with detroit diesel epa07 and epa10, dd13 and dd15/16 engines, manufactured from january 20, 2006, through february 20, 2012.  The pump to rail high pressure fuel line support system used on these engines is sensitive to assembly torque and may be damaged during service work.  As a result of other repairs, the line supports may loosen, potentially leading to fuel line cracking and a fuel leak.  

Consequence
A fuel leak could create a road hazard, increasing the risk of a crash.  Also a fuel leak in the presence of an ignition source can result in a fire.  

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ners, and where necessary, the high pressure fuel line support system will be replaced by dtna authorized service facilities, free of charge.  The safety recall began on april 27, 2012.  Owners may contact dtna at 1-800-547-0712.

DEFECT #9 - PO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ION


Posted on: 2013-12-24
Description
Daimler trucks north america (dtna) is recalling certain model year 2009-2014 model year freightliner business class m2 and freightliner custom chassis mt45 and mt55 chassis manufactured august 27, 2008, through december 10, 2013 and equipped with eaton hybrid automated transmissions.  The software controlling the affected transmissions may improperly raise the vehicle's engine speed during downshifts without the driver's input.

Consequence
The increase in engine speed may result in unintended acceleration, increasing the risk of a crash.

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ners and dealers will update the hybrid transmission software, free of charge.  The recall began on february 5, 2014.  Owners may contact dtna at 1-503-745-6910.  Dtna's recall number is fl-657.

DEFECT #10 - SERVICE BRAKES, AIR:DISC:CALIPER


Posted on: 2016-04-12
Description
Daimler trucks north america llc (dtna) is recalling certain model year 2010-2017 freightliner m2 business class, 108sd, 114sd, and columbia trucks manufactured from january 6, 2010, through february 29, 2016, equipped with certain bendix rear disk brakes and spring suspensions.  The rear disk brake caliper may have been installed incorrectly, thus allowing the caliper to contact the suspension.

Consequence
Caliper contact with the spring suspension may reduce the braking effectiveness, increasing the risk of a crash.

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ners, and dealers will correct the orientation of the rear brake calipers, as necessary, free of charge.  The recall began on june 8, 2016.  Owners may contact dtna customer service at 1-800-547-0712.  Dtna's recall number for this campaign is fl-705.

DEFECT #11 - EXTERIOR LIGHTING


Posted on: 2020-04-15
Description
Daimler trucks north america llc (dtna) is recalling certain 2006-2020 freightliner columbia, 2006-2021 freightliner business class m2, 2007-2020 freightliner coronado, 2014-2021 freightliner 122 sd, 2007 sterling a 9500, 2006 freightliner argosy, 2006-2007 sterling at9500, 2008-2021 freightliner cascadia, 2006-2008 freightliner classic, 2006-2011 freightliner century class, 2006-2010 freightliner fld, and 2017 western star 5700 vehicles.  The rear reflective tape may be partially covered by the mudflap hanger bracket, which may reduce the vehicle's visibility to other drivers on the road.  As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of federal motor vehicle safety standard (fmvss) number 108, lamps, reflective devices, and associated equipment.  

Consequence
The vehicle's rearward visibility may be reduced, increasing the risk of a crash.  

Corrective Action
Dtna will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and reposition the reflective tape to ensure that it is completely visible, as necessary, free of charge.  The recall began may 29, 2020.  Owners may contact dtna customer service at 1-800-547-0712.  Dtna's number for this recall is fl848.
